Looking to settle down without giving up the convenience of city living? The Northside neighborhood of Fort Worth brings together the best of both worlds. “It still has a hometown feel to it,” says local Realtor Maria Montes with Rendon Realty. “It’s not super industrial or super modern like Dallas just yet. You’ve got the historic Stockyards nearby which are five minutes away. And you kind of got the small-town feel with all of the elements of the big city.” With popular attractions like the Stockyards and Panther Island Music Pavilion just a short drive away, you can easily spend your nights and weekends exploring all the excitement that Fort Worth has to offer. You’ll also be just minutes away from shopping and dining desinations like West 7th Street or downtown Fort Worth.

When you’re not out exploring the nearby attractions, you’ll be spending time at home in the neighborhood, which offers a wide mix of housing styles sure to fit any desire and budget. “You can find some Craftsman. Northside has really kind of got some traditional homes,” Montes says. “A lot of them were built in the 1900s, so you’ve got some wrap-around porches, you’ve got a lot of character, you’ve got a lot of built-in shelving in these homes, big windows.” In addition to the traditional Craftsman homes that are in the neighborhood, there is some new construction happening throughout the area. You can easily find new one-story homes with brick and stone exteriors and built-in garages. Despite the new development, Montes says the neighborhood is keeping its historic charm. Homes in Northside are about in line or somewhat cheaper than the median home price in all of Fort Worth. Some homes are listed for $350,000 to $375,000, but you can also find homes in the $200,000 range.

Students in Northside will have a quick commute to school in the mornings as there are several public schools throughout the neighborhood. Students might attend either Sam Rosen Elementary School, Elder Middle School and North Side High School. North Side High traces its roots back to 1884, when the community – then known as Marine – needed a schoolhouse. The original school building is now located in Log Cabin Village, a collection of historic buildings that have been restored in the city. North Side has been in its current location since 1937. The modern Art Deco building has Greek and Roman-inspired features such as columns and urns. The school is known for its mariachi band, which won the national championship in Los Angeles in 2017, and has performed at Carnegie Hall in New York City.

Several parks in the neighborhood offer plenty of room to get outside and enjoy some recreation. Buck Sansom Park has two softball fields and an open field that can be used for soccer games. The park has access to the Trinity Trail system, giving residents a scenic space for a stroll. Head to Marine Park for a game of basketball or tennis or test your skills oat the skate park. Marine Park is also home to an aquatic center with a lap pool and playground, making it a popular place to spend time during the summer.

For a good meal, check out Riscky’s BAR-B-Q on Azle Avenue. This local restaurant has been around since 1927, serving smoked meats and authentic Texas barbecue to the community. Known for their brisket and ribs, locals say the portions are large and will leave you feeling full after your meal. For all of your grocery and errands needs, you can head to the Walmart Supercenter just across Jacksboro Highway. And with the Highway and Interstate 820 bordering the neighborhood, you’ll have a quick trip anywhere you need to go throughout the Metroplex.
